About this data. Source: the New York City Department of Finance 2027 supplemental property roll — a public record listing properties that may fall within the scope of the non-primary-residence (“pied-à-terre”) surcharge — shown against the full FY27 assessment roll of every parcel in the city. Owner names and addresses are reproduced as published by DOF.

Parcels drawn in grey are on the city assessment roll but not on the supplemental roll; white parcels are on the supplemental roll. Grey is context, not a judgement — a great deal of the city (airports, parks, offices, most commercial property) was never in scope for this surcharge in the first place.

Parcels marked in red match the criteria DOF published for the surcharge — broadly, class 1 houses over $5M and condo or co-op units at $1M and above. DOF describes the roll as including but not limited to properties that may be subject, and a property used as the owner’s primary residence is generally exempt, so a red mark means may be subject, never that tax is owed.

Dollar figures are DOF full market value (FMV) estimates used for assessment purposes. They are not sale prices, appraisals, or listing prices. Appearing on this roll does not mean the tax applies to a property — eligibility depends on residency and other facts that are not in this dataset. Records may contain errors carried over from the source roll.
